TBIT Terminal Refresh Design Manager

Overview

Cordoba Corporation is a leading engineering and design firm based in California. We are seeking a TBIT Terminal Refresh Design Manager to support an airport project within the Facilities Sector. The TBIT Terminal Refresh Design Manager reports to the TBIT Terminal Refresh Project Managerand is responsible for the design management of the TBIT Terminal Refresh Project. The TBIT Terminal Refresh Project will perform major renovations of the TBIT departures and arrivals levels toinclude new Terrazzo, ceilings, wall linings, information booths, ticket counters, common-use self-service kiosks as well as reconfiguration of the domestic baggage claim and recheck area. The characteristi cs of the candidate shall include a solid understanding of airport terminal functi onsand assets such as passenger processing, baggage processing, airline operati ons, and aircraft /apronrequirements.The individual must be knowledgeable in all design deliverables and be able to recognize quality vs. incomplete design work and take appropriate actions accordingly. The individual shall be driven to “think outside the box” and find design solutions while collaborating with stakeholders and designers.

 

The TBIT Terminal Refresh Design Manager establishes and monitors procedures for architectural & engineering review activities to ensure they are done according to best practices and standards identified in the Contract. The TBIT Terminal Refresh Design Manager shall oversee design supportmanagement, scope of work management, design review and approval, permitti ng, agencycoordinati on support, and building informati on modelling (BIM) coordinati on. The TBIT Terminal Refresh Design Manager supports the TBIT Terminal Refresh Project Manager in providing oversightof the architectural, structural, mechanical electrical plumbing (MEP), civil, utilities, and IT disciplines per LAWA standards.

Responsibilities

  • Overseeing the review and approval of technical documents
  • Lending expertise to manage comment resolution
  • Facilitating meetings and being the technical liaison between the Developers/Design-Builders and TDIP Subject Matter Expert teams
  • Working with the TBIT Terminal Refresh Project Manager in defining, reviewing and/or approving design requirements, responsibilities and program consistency
  • Providing guidance to the TBIT Terminal Refresh Project Manager should design requirementscontained in the project documents not be clearly defi ned
  • Providing technical review of changes to scope of work for each project
  • Establishing submitt al approval procedures and ensure uniformity of review approach
  • Auditing project team comments and designer responses
  • Monitoring compliance with architectural and engineering guidelines for the TBIT Terminal Refresh Project ensuring consistency and quality in design
  • Monitoring permitti ng informati on and the permitti ng process required by the design team
  • Supporti ng the TBIT Terminal Refresh Project Manager to ensure design reviews are completedon ti me and within budget
  • Developing and maintaining TBIT Terminal Refresh Project scope tracker to verify that all scopeelements are accounted for and have been or will be assigned to a project
  • Providing guidance related to the functi onal requirements contained in the technicalspecifi cati ons or other project documents supplied by LAWA
  • Monitoring BIM producti ons of all designers and contractors according to LAWA BIM Standards,the BIM Executi on Plan, and needs of the TBIT Terminal Refresh Project. The TBIT TerminalRefresh Design Manager is responsible for working with LAWA’s Central Building Informati onManagement (cBIM) to develop the strategy for BIM implementation and review
  • Acting as technical liaison for the design review processes and comment resolution incoordination with the project manager and the Design Review Team (DRT).
  • Managing the distribution of the design documents to the LAWA Design Review Team (DRT) for review and coordinating meetings for comment resolutions.
  • Providing technical support and coordination between the TBIT Terminal Refresh Project team and other TDIP project teams for program consistency across all disciplines
  • Providing technical Support for adjacent LAWA projects as required to ensure accurate interface
  • Providing technical coordinati on for project consistency across all disciplines
  • Preparing and reviewing briefings, meeting agendas, and supporting materials for various meetings including Board presentations, Steering Committee meeting, Stakeholder outreach,and other TDIP meetings

Qualifications

  • 15 years or more experience in managing the design of large, complex building projects, utilities and infrastructure improvements, preferably on airport projects
  •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Architecture, Engineering, and/or related field required
  • Professionally licensed Architect and/or Engineer strongly preferred
  • Design management of complex aviation improvements experience required
  • Experience managing a team of design professionals
  • Experience with projects more than $100 million in value.
  • Experience with various delivery methods, including Design-Bid-Build, Design+CMAR and Design/Build
  • Proven ability to perform in a management capacity
  • Excellent written and oral communicati on skills and a thorough knowledge of industry practices and regulations
  • Must have a self-starter atti tude with proactive, results-oriented focus; and willing and capable to assume additional responsibilities
  • Must be able to interface with a variety of people with different technical levels and educational backgrounds
  • Must be detail oriented and highly organized
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ite and Bluebeam
  • Familiarity with Project Management Information Systems
  • Ability to work in CAD or REVIT a plus

 

Salary Range: $136,000 to $154,000 per year

Location: Los Angeles, CA.

Work Environment: Onsite
